Bayesian Methods in Marine Biology: Estimating Populations and Viability
This chapter explores the use of Bayesian methods in marine biology, focusing on endangered species like Florida manatees and northern right whales. It addresses the limitations of traditional methods in aerial surveys and illustrates how Bayesian models can provide more accurate population estimates and assessments of ecological impacts.
